Exports In 2022, United States exported $163M in Unfilled Chocolate Blocks/Bars (Contains Cocoa, >2kg), making it the 9th largest exporter of Unfilled Chocolate Blocks/Bars (Contains Cocoa, >2kg) in the world. At the same year, Unfilled Chocolate Blocks/Bars (Contains Cocoa, >2kg) was the 1141st most exported product in United States. The main destination of Unfilled Chocolate Blocks/Bars (Contains Cocoa, >2kg) exports from United States are: Canada ($75.2M), South Korea ($10.4M), Mexico ($9.96M), Australia ($6.29M), and Philippines ($5.34M).
The fastest growing export markets for Unfilled Chocolate Blocks/Bars (Contains Cocoa, >2kg) of United States between 2021 and 2022 were Canada ($6.29M), Singapore ($1.65M), and Philippines ($1.4M).
Imports In 2022, United States imported $687M in Unfilled Chocolate Blocks/Bars (Contains Cocoa, >2kg), becoming the 1st largest importer of Unfilled Chocolate Blocks/Bars (Contains Cocoa, >2kg) in the world. At the same year, Unfilled Chocolate Blocks/Bars (Contains Cocoa, >2kg) was the 689th most imported product in United States. United States imports Unfilled Chocolate Blocks/Bars (Contains Cocoa, >2kg) primarily from: Canada ($284M), Mexico ($123M), Germany ($67.6M), Switzerland ($45.1M), and Belgium ($37.4M).
The fastest growing import markets in Unfilled Chocolate Blocks/Bars (Contains Cocoa, >2kg) for United States between 2021 and 2022 were Canada ($30.6M), Mexico ($23.7M), and Germany ($11.9M).
